DTF Printing Sustainability: Reducing Environmental Footprint from Ink to Waste Management

DTF printing sustainability invites printers to look beyond the surface and assess the entire supply chain. Ink chemistry, film durability, and adhesive choices all affect lifecycle impact, and practical improvements exist: selecting recyclable transfer films, minimizing offcuts, and optimizing layouts to reduce ink usage. The journey toward a smaller footprint also includes energy considerations, such as using LED curing options and adopting inks that cure at lower temperatures without sacrificing adhesion or vibrancy.

Green printing practices in California extend from the shop floor to procurement. Local suppliers with clear environmental data, responsible packaging, and take-back programs help close the loop. Pairing responsible sourcing with efficient waste management reduces landfill waste and supports California’s broader sustainability goals. In practice, printers can organize supplier audits, request EPDs or LCAs, and publicly communicate the environmental benefits of their DTF operations to customers.

Water-Based Inks for DTF: Balancing Color, Feel, and Energy Savings

Water-based inks for DTF offer a compelling balance of color performance, fabric hand feel, and energy efficiency. These formulations can reduce curing demands, potentially lowering energy costs while maintaining wash-fastness and color vibrancy across common apparel fabrics. For eco-friendly garment printing California operations, water-based inks for DTF can be a centerpiece of a greener portfolio when matched with compatible substrates and adhesives.

Choosing water-based inks for DTF also invites attention to waste and water management. Manufacturers often provide guidelines on waste-water cleanliness and recycling of rinses, which aligns with broader sustainability goals. By pairing water-based inks with recyclable or compostable backings and responsibly managing post-print cleanup, printers bolster their green credentials within California’s manufacturing ecosystem.

Implementing a Sustainable CA DTF Workflow: Practical Steps for Printers

Implementing a Sustainable CA DTF Workflow requires cross-functional alignment and clear metrics. Start by auditing the current workflow to identify energy, water, and material hotspots, and set targets for reductions. Prioritize eco-friendly garment printing California values by testing low-VOC inks and water-based inks for DTF on representative fabrics before scaling.

Next, optimize color management, invest in energy-efficient equipment such as LED-curing systems, and implement a waste management program that recycles films and offcuts. Training staff and communicating progress to customers reinforces your commitment to DTF printing sustainability and helps differentiate the business in a competitive market. By documenting progress with LCAs or third-party verifications, shops can build trust while delivering quality at lower environmental cost.
